Andrew Morrison Praises Morocco’s Restraint and Security Tolerance During Recent Gatherings Ban

London – British MP and former Foreign Minister Andrew Morrison praised the Moroccan law enforcement’s intervention over the past weekend to prevent unauthorized gatherings, affirming that it demonstrated “tolerance and restraint in maintaining public order.”

In a statement to the Moroccan News Agency, Morrison noted that citizens, as in other countries, seek to improve their standard of living, highlighting that this sometimes manifests in the streets.

He emphasized that Morocco allows legitimate demonstrations, and that the security authorities handle these events with control and wisdom, reflecting the kingdom’s ability to establish itself as a model of peace, security, stability, and the rule of law in the region.

Morrison pointed to the significant progress the kingdom has made in economic, political, democratic, and social fields, affirming that these achievements contribute to enhancing Morocco’s position on the regional and international stage.

In closing his statement, he remarked that the kingdom combines stability with respect for citizens’ rights, making it a model to emulate in the region.
